When the Mirage opened on the strip, it was recognized as the first Mega Resort. Reportedly needing to earn over $1 million per day, Steve Wynn knew that he had to have the most impressive and family friendly show in Las Vegas. Thus began the creation of the Siegfried and Roy show.

Beginning in 1990, the show featured the two German born magicians, who already had an impressive resume on the strip along with showgirls, and more wild animals than had ever appeared on one stage. Siegfreid and Roy became the caretakers and saviors of the White Tiger, which were near extinction in the 1980's.

After a stint with the original MGM Grand's Hallelujah Hollywood and a return to the Lido, Siegfried and Roy at last starred in their own full-length production show, Beyond Belief, which ran at the Strip's Frontier hotel-casino from 1981 to 1988. In 1990 they were hired by Steve Wynn, then owner of The Mirage, for an annual guarantee of $57 million. A specially built showroom was constructed in the Mirage allowing the pair the technological luxuries to create astounding new illusions. Pop superstar Michael Jackson wrote a special theme for the show and British set designer John Napier created a jaw dropping environment and showroom to house the illusions and myriad of exotic animals who ran chain free around the stage. With the best lighting rig and sound system on earth at the time the show was for a long time the ultimate Las Vegas show. In 2001, they signed a lifetime contract with the hotel. The duo has appeared in around 5,750 shows together, mostly at The Mirage.

Danny Gans appeared in the specially built Danny Gans Theater at the Mirage. His show played from 1996 until 2008. In 2009 Gans opened at Steve Wynn Encore with a ten year contract. Unfortunately, Mr. Gans died suddenly only 4 months into his agreement. Gan's talent was unmistakable. His history in Las Vegas goes back to a time he opened for Bill Cosby at The Hilton. Danny was supposed to do 30 minutes. Towards the end of his bit, Cosby walked on stage and introduced Danny Gans to the audience as the New Sammy Davis Jr. With that said Cosby told Gans to keep going and he performed for another 30 minutes. The next day, Bill Cosby had the marquee changed to make Gans name equal to his own.

Now appearing in the old Danny Gans theater ( re named the Terry Fator theater ) is the Singing Ventriloquist Terry Fator. 2006 winner of NBC hit TV Talent show America's got Talent Fator was soon snapped up by Las Vegas at first appearing at the Las Vegas Hilton during Barry Manilow's dark weeks. Eventually The Mirage offered Fator a reported $100 million 5 year contract to jump ship. His repertoire includes singing impressions of Kermit the Frog, Etta James, and Elvis Presley. His conversations with the puppets are hilarious, with Fator playing the straight man.

After the Siegfried and Roy show was cut short after a tragic accident where a white tiger attacked Roy live on stage in 2004 Cirque du Soleil where asked to create a show for the Mirage. Completely overhauling the Siegfried and Roy showroom creating a new in the round layout. Cirque created LOVE a tribute to the Beatles with their music and images being accompanied by the art and artistry of Cirque du Soleil.
